Re: [PATCH v4 1/5] net: macb: fix wakeup test in runtime suspend/resume routines
From: Jakub Kicinski
Date:  Wed May 06 2020 - 16:18:48 EST
On Wed, 6 May 2020 13:37:37 +0200 nicolas.ferre@xxxxxxxxxxxxx wrote:
> From: Nicolas Ferre <nicolas.ferre@xxxxxxxxxxxxx>
> 
> Use the proper struct device pointer to check if the wakeup flag
> and wakeup source are positioned.
> Use the one passed by function call which is equivalent to
> &bp->dev->dev.parent.
> 
> It's preventing the trigger of a spurious interrupt in case the
> Wake-on-Lan feature is used.
